#9dbb6f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9dbb6f is composed of 61.6% red, 73.3%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.6%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 83.7 degrees, a saturation of 35.8% and a lightness of 58.4%. #9dbb6f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ffde with #3b7700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#9dbb6f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f8faf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9dbb6f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969a90 is the less saturated color, while #abfc2e is the most saturated one.
